Hyderabad: Justice T Madhavi Devi of the Telangana High Court on Tuesday issued notices in a writ petition filed by a farmer alleging denial of crop loan waiver benefits despite eligibility under the State scheme.
The writ petition was filed by Baddam Narsimha Reddy, seeking implementation of the Crop Loan Waiver Scheme notified under GO Rt No. 567, Agriculture and Cooperation (Agri-II) Department, dated July 15, 2024, in respect of a crop loan availed by him.
The petitioner contended that he had obtained a crop loan and had submitted a detailed representation on December 20, 2025, requesting waiver of the loan in terms of the Government Order. However, the authorities failed to process his claim, while extending the benefit of the very same scheme to others similarly placed.
Alleging arbitrary and discriminatory action, the petitioner argued that the non-implementation of the loan waiver in his case amounts to a violation of Article 14 of the Constitution of India. He sought a direction to the authorities to forthwith process and grant loan waiver in his favour in accordance with the Government Order.
The Government Pleader for Agriculture and Cooperation and the Government Pleader for Revenue sought time to obtain instructions.
The Court directed issuance of notice to the Branch Manager, Canara Bank-Aroor Branch in Yadadri Bhongir district. The matter has been posted for further hearing on February 3, 2026.
